Tumdiwal - Mardapal, Kondagaon

Tumdiwal is a village situated in the Mardapal tehsil of Kondagaon district, Chhattisgarh. It is located approximately 55 km from Kondagaon and around 80 km from Jagdalpur. Tumadiwal serves as the Gram Panchayat for Tumdiwal village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Tumdiwal is 448729. The village covers a total geographical area of 2521.13 hectares and falls under the 494226 pincode. Kondagaon is the nearest town, located about 55 km away.

Tumdiwal village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Narayanpur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Bastar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Tumdiwal

As per Census 2011, Tumdiwal village has a total population of 872 people, consisting of 429 males and 443 females. The village has 174 households and a sex ratio of 1,032 females per 1,000 males. There are 177 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 41 literate and 831 illiterate residents. Additionally, 868 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
